A powerful and versatile flash, the Speedlite EX II will expand your shooting options with a Guide Number of 43, wireless slave flash ability, nine custom functions and a mm zoom head.
The EX works as a wireless slave, but not as a transmitter. Good. Loads of power. Easy-to-use dedicated controls. Easy-to-read rear LCD. Super-fast and silent recycling. You can just keep shooting and the EX II keeps blasting out the power with no waiting. Missing. No built-in bounce card. No "A" mode for use with ancient non-TTL cameras. First set the EX II in the right mode. Press-and-HOLD the "Zoom" button for about 2 seconds or so. This activates a menu that lets you put the flash in either a single-fash mode vs. remote "slave" mode. Use half-circle buttons to toggle it to read "slave". Press the "set" button (in the middle of those half-circle shape buttons.). The EXII can act as a slave to a Canon master unit (pop-up flash in a D or later dRebel, 60D or later XXD, 7D, and 1DX, ST-E2, 90EX, EX, EX, EXII, or EX). To get "dumb" slave capability, you have to add-on an optical slave unit, and again there is something odd in the Canon EX circuitry that means a great many of the more generic add-on optical slaves may not work.
